+#include "form.priv.h"
+
+MODULE_ID("$Id$")
+
+#if HAVE_LOCALE_H
+#include <locale.h>
+#endif
+
+#if HAVE_LOCALE_H
+#define isDecimalPoint(c) ((c) == ((L && L->decimal_point) ? *(L->decimal_point) : '.'))
+#else
+#define isDecimalPoint(c) ((c) == '.')
+#endif
+
+#if USE_WIDEC_SUPPORT
+#define isDigit(c) (iswdigit((wint_t)(c)) || isdigit(UChar(c)))
+#else
+#define isDigit(c) isdigit(UChar(c))
+#endif
+
+#define thisARG numericARG
+
+typedef struct
+ {
+ int precision;
+ double low;
+ double high;
+ struct lconv *L;
+ }
+thisARG;
+
+typedef struct
+ {
+ int precision;
+ double low;
+ double high;
+ }
+thisPARM;
+
+/*---------------------------------------------------------------------------
+| Facility : libnform
+| Function : static void *Generic_This_Type(void * arg)
+|
+| Description : Allocate structure for numeric type argument.
+|
+| Return Values : Pointer to argument structure or NULL on error
++--------------------------------------------------------------------------*/
+static void *
+Generic_This_Type(void *arg)
+{
+ thisARG *argn = (thisARG *) 0;
+ thisPARM *args = (thisPARM *) arg;
+
+ if (args)
+ {
+ argn = typeMalloc(thisARG, 1);
+
+ if (argn)
+ {
+ T((T_CREATE("thisARG %p"), (void *)argn));
+ argn->precision = args->precision;
+ argn->low = args->low;
+ argn->high = args->high;
+
+#if HAVE_LOCALE_H
+ argn->L = localeconv();
+#else
+ argn->L = NULL;
+#endif
+ }
+ }
+ return (void *)argn;
+}
+
+/*---------------------------------------------------------------------------
+| Facility : libnform
+| Function : static void *Make_This_Type(va_list * ap)
+|
+| Description : Allocate structure for numeric type argument.
+|
+| Return Values : Pointer to argument structure or NULL on error
++--------------------------------------------------------------------------*/
+static void *
+Make_This_Type(va_list *ap)
+{
+ thisPARM arg;
+
+ arg.precision = va_arg(*ap, int);
+ arg.low = va_arg(*ap, double);
+ arg.high = va_arg(*ap, double);
+
+ return Generic_This_Type((void *)&arg);
+}
+
+/*---------------------------------------------------------------------------
+| Facility : libnform
+| Function : static void *Copy_This_Type(const void * argp)
+|
+| Description : Copy structure for numeric type argument.
+|
+| Return Values : Pointer to argument structure or NULL on error.
++--------------------------------------------------------------------------*/
+static void *
+Copy_This_Type(const void *argp)
+{
+ const thisARG *ap = (const thisARG *)argp;
+ thisARG *result = (thisARG *) 0;
+
+ if (argp)
+ {
+ result = typeMalloc(thisARG, 1);
+ if (result)
+ {
+ T((T_CREATE("thisARG %p"), (void *)result));
+ *result = *ap;
+ }
+ }
+ return (void *)result;
+}
+
+/*---------------------------------------------------------------------------
+| Facility : libnform
+| Function : static void Free_This_Type(void * argp)
+|
+| Description : Free structure for numeric type argument.
+|
+| Return Values : -
++--------------------------------------------------------------------------*/
+static void
+Free_This_Type(void *argp)
+{
+ if (argp)
+ free(argp);
+}
+
+/*---------------------------------------------------------------------------
+| Facility : libnform
+| Function : static bool Check_This_Field(FIELD * field,
+| const void * argp)
+|
+| Description : Validate buffer content to be a valid numeric value
+|
+| Return Values : TRUE - field is valid
+| FALSE - field is invalid
++--------------------------------------------------------------------------*/
+static bool
+Check_This_Field(FIELD *field, const void *argp)
+{
+ const thisARG *argn = (const thisARG *)argp;
+ double low = argn->low;
+ double high = argn->high;
+ int prec = argn->precision;
+ unsigned char *bp = (unsigned char *)field_buffer(field, 0);
+ char *s = (char *)bp;
+ double val = 0.0;
+ struct lconv *L = argn->L;
+ char buf[64];
+ bool result = FALSE;
+
+ while (*bp && *bp == ' ')
+ bp++;
+ if (*bp)
+ {
+ if (*bp == '-' || *bp == '+')
+ bp++;
+#if USE_WIDEC_SUPPORT
+ if (*bp)
+ {
+ bool blank = FALSE;
+ int state = 0;
+ int len;
+ int n;
+ wchar_t *list = _nc_Widen_String((char *)bp, &len);
+
+ if (list != 0)
+ {
+ result = TRUE;
+ for (n = 0; n < len; ++n)
+ {
+ if (blank)
+ {
+ if (list[n] != ' ')
+ {
+ result = FALSE;
+ break;
+ }
+ }
+ else if (list[n] == ' ')
+ {
+ blank = TRUE;
+ }
+ else if (isDecimalPoint(list[n]))
+ {
+ if (++state > 1)
+ {
+ result = FALSE;
+ break;
+ }
+ }
+ else if (!isDigit(list[n]))
+ {
+ result = FALSE;
+ break;
+ }
+ }
+ free(list);
+ }
+ }
+#else
+ while (*bp)
+ {
+ if (!isdigit(UChar(*bp)))
+ break;
+ bp++;
+ }
+ if (isDecimalPoint(*bp))
+ {
+ bp++;
+ while (*bp)
+ {
+ if (!isdigit(UChar(*bp)))
+ break;
+ bp++;
+ }
+ }
+ while (*bp && *bp == ' ')
+ bp++;
+ result = (*bp == '\0');
+#endif
+ if (result)
+ {
+ val = atof(s);
+ if (low < high)
+ {
+ if (val < low || val > high)
+ result = FALSE;
+ }
+ if (result)
+ {
+ sprintf(buf, "%.*f", (prec > 0 ? prec : 0), val);
+ set_field_buffer(field, 0, buf);
+ }
+ }
+ }
+ return (result);
+}
+
+/*---------------------------------------------------------------------------
+| Facility : libnform
+| Function : static bool Check_This_Character(
+| int c,
+| const void * argp)
+|
+| Description : Check a character for the numeric type.
+|
+| Return Values : TRUE - character is valid
+| FALSE - character is invalid
++--------------------------------------------------------------------------*/
+static bool
+Check_This_Character(int c, const void *argp)
+{
+ const thisARG *argn = (const thisARG *)argp;
+ struct lconv *L = argn->L;
+
+ return ((isDigit(c) ||
+ c == '+' ||
+ c == '-' ||
+ isDecimalPoint(c))
+ ? TRUE
+ : FALSE);
+}
+
+static FIELDTYPE typeTHIS =
+{
+ _HAS_ARGS | _RESIDENT,
+ 1, /* this is mutable, so we can't be const */
+ (FIELDTYPE *)0,
+ (FIELDTYPE *)0,
+ Make_This_Type,
+ Copy_This_Type,
+ Free_This_Type,
+ INIT_FT_FUNC(Check_This_Field),
+ INIT_FT_FUNC(Check_This_Character),
+ INIT_FT_FUNC(NULL),
+ INIT_FT_FUNC(NULL),
+#if NCURSES_INTEROP_FUNCS
+ Generic_This_Type
+#endif
+};
+
+NCURSES_EXPORT_VAR(FIELDTYPE*) TYPE_NUMERIC = &typeTHIS;
+
+#if NCURSES_INTEROP_FUNCS
+/* The next routines are to simplify the use of ncurses from
+ programming languages with restictions on interop with C level
+ constructs (e.g. variable access or va_list + ellipsis constructs)
+*/
+NCURSES_EXPORT(FIELDTYPE *)
+_nc_TYPE_NUMERIC(void)
+{
+ return TYPE_NUMERIC;
+}
+#endif
+
+/* fty_num.c ends here */
